Snowflake Summit '25

Snowflake's annual user conference is returning to San Francisco. Register today and save on a full conference pass.

Understanding AI Data Pipelines

An AI pipeline comprises a series of processes that convert raw data into actionable insights, enabling businesses to make informed decisions and drive innovation.

  • Overview
  • Understanding AI Pipelines
  • The Importance of AI Pipelines
  • Stages of an AI Pipeline
  • Integrating AI Pipelines with Cloud Platforms
  • Challenges in Building AI Pipelines
  • Future Trends in AI Pipelines
  • Resources

Overview

Today’s business leaders must understand AI pipelines to realize the full potential of AI. An AI pipeline transforms raw data into actionable insights, empowering businesses to make informed decisions and drive innovation. These pipelines optimize operations, enhance predictive accuracy and boost efficiency. As AI technologies advance, a strong pipeline architecture becomes essential for maintaining a competitive edge. Let’s explore the core components of AI pipelines, their significance, key stages and how cloud integration can optimize your data strategy.

Understanding AI Pipelines

An AI pipeline is a structured framework that supports the development, training and deployment of AI models. It automates various stages of transforming raw data into actionable insights, including data collection, preprocessing, model training, evaluation and deployment. This systematic approach enables organizations to efficiently leverage AI while maintaining high-quality outputs. Key components of an AI pipeline include data ingestion, data preprocessing, feature engineering, model training and model deployment. Continuous monitoring and maintenance help ensure the model performs optimally over time.

AI data pipelines differ from traditional data pipelines in focus and functionality. While traditional pipelines move and process large volumes of data, AI data pipelines support iterative model development and complex machine learning workflows. By leveraging modern cloud platforms, organizations can build robust AI pipelines that enhance analytical capabilities and drive innovation.

The Importance of AI Pipelines

AI pipelines are essential for organizations looking to harness AI effectively. Implementing AI data pipelines allows businesses to streamline data processing and model deployment, resulting in improved operational efficiency. One significant benefit is the automation of repetitive tasks, freeing up valuable time for data scientists and engineers to focus on strategic initiatives.

AI pipelines also enhance data-driven decision-making. A structured approach to data collection, processing and analysis allows organizations to derive insights faster and more accurately. This enables decision-makers to respond swiftly to market changes and customer needs, driving competitive advantage. AI pipeline architecture helps ensure data is accessible and contextualized, facilitating informed decision-making.

Moreover, AI pipelines automate machine learning processes. Standardizing workflows facilitates the seamless transition from data ingestion to model training and evaluation, significantly reducing the time from concept to deployment. Automation minimizes human error, helping ensure models are trained on high-quality data and consistently optimized for performance. Investing in AI pipelines is a strategic move for any organization aiming to leverage AI technologies to enhance productivity and innovation.

Stages of an AI Pipeline

The AI pipeline consists of several crucial stages that transform raw data into actionable insights. The first stage is data ingestion and preprocessing, where data from various sources is collected and cleaned. This step helps ensure data is accurate, relevant and formatted correctly for analysis. Efficient data integration and transformation are crucial here.

Next comes model training and evaluation. In this stage, machine learning algorithms are applied to the preprocessed data to create predictive models. This involves selecting the right algorithms, tuning hyperparameters and validating the model’s performance against a test data set. Scalable architectures allow data scientists to quickly iterate on model training, refining models based on evaluation metrics.

The final stage involves deployment and monitoring of models. Once a model is trained and validated, it must be deployed into a production environment where it can make real-time predictions. Monitoring is critical to help ensure the model performs as expected and to identify any potential drift in data patterns over time. Robust analytics capabilities facilitate ongoing monitoring, allowing organizations to adapt and optimize their models continuously for better performance.

Integrating AI Pipelines with Cloud Platforms

Cloud platforms revolutionize the performance of AI data pipelines by providing a robust, scalable data platform that can handle vast amounts of data with ease. Leveraging cloud architecture allows data scientists and engineers to efficiently process and analyze data, leading to faster model training and improved accuracy. The separation of storage and compute resources enables teams to scale based on specific needs, enabling optimal performance during peak workloads.

Utilizing cloud solutions for data storage and management simplifies the complexities of AI projects. A cloud-native platform provides a single source of truth for all data, helping ensure teams can access clean, consolidated data sets without the hassle of silos. With powerful data-sharing capabilities, organizations can securely share data across departments or with external partners, fostering collaboration and accelerating AI development. Collaborative environments within cloud platforms enhance integration of various data sources and tools into cohesive workflows, empowering organizations to innovate faster and more effectively in their AI initiatives.

Challenges in Building AI Pipelines

Building effective AI pipelines comes with challenges that can impede progress. One common obstacle is ensuring high-quality data. Poor data quality can lead to inaccurate predictions and flawed models, compromising AI initiatives. Data can be incomplete, inconsistent or outdated, making robust data governance and validation processes essential.

To address data quality issues, organizations should adopt strategies including regular data cleaning, validation checks and integration of diverse data sources. Leveraging advanced analytics and machine learning techniques can also help identify anomalies and improve data accuracy. Cloud platforms support seamless data integration and provide tools for data profiling, maintaining high standards of data integrity.

Another significant challenge is maintaining pipeline scalability and flexibility. As organizations grow and data volumes increase, AI pipelines must scale accordingly. This requires a modular design that allows for easy updates and incorporation of new data sources or processing techniques. Cloud-based solutions provide the necessary scalability without compromising performance, ensuring AI pipelines remain agile and responsive to changing business needs.